Bonding Adhesive Cartridge seashell 9 oz from Princeton Chemical is a seam adhesive designed for surfacing work where color and joint quality matter. This cartridge is described as ideal for fabricating countertops, bathroom vanities, wall panels, and other surfaces, so it serves as a core material for building and finishing these projects. The adhesive is formulated to produce tough, virtually invisible bonds on a variety of surfacing materials, which supports clean seams that do not distract from the finished surface. It is specified for use on cast polymers, acrylics, polyester blends, engineered quartz, and natural stone, giving one product that can be applied across mixed materials on the same job. The 9 oz cartridge format supports consistent dispensing through appropriate tools, helping maintain steady bead size and controlled application along seams.
This Princeton Chemical seam adhesive in a 9 oz cartridge is structured for controlled dispensing, so the adhesive can be driven through a suitable applicator to maintain consistent flow along the joint line. The stated output of approximately 40 feet of a 1/4 inch bead per cartridge ties bead diameter directly to coverage, helping size jobs and estimate material usage before cutting or routing seams.
